Background technique
Transformer core assembling mode has overlapping method and to two kinds of folded method, and overlapping method is by the one-to-one friendship of the opening of silicon steel sheet Both sides are alternately distributed in, this folded method is more troublesome, but silicon steel sheet gap is small, and magnetic resistance is small, is conducive to increase magnetic flux, therefore power supply Transformer in this way is usually used in folded method to be connected with the occasion of DC current, to avoid DC current from causing to be saturated, silicon It needs that there are gaps between steel disc, therefore folded method is respectively put E piece and I piece on one side, gap between the two can be adjusted with the scraps of paper Section, there are many transformer core type, can be divided into A by its manufacture craft difference: calcination (black-film), N: without two kinds of of calcination (white tiles) Difference can be divided into shape: EI type, UI type, c-type, the shape of the mouth as one speaks, and shape of the mouth as one speaks silicon steel sheet often uses in the biggish transformer of power, it Good insulation preformance, while magnetic circuit is short, is mainly used for power greater than 500-1000W and high-power transformer.
Usually be fastened together by four side frames after traditional transformer core overlapping, then by screw rod attaching nut into Row connection, this traditional fixed form is poor to the stability maintenance of iron core, and fixed not enough fastening.

The utility model have it is following the utility model has the advantages that
(1) the transformer fe core assembly installation assembly by transformer core group two sides be symmetrically arranged with the first fixed frame and Second fixed frame, and be attached between the first fixed frame and the second fixed frame by connecting screw mating connection frame, then cooperate Top fixed frame and bottom fixing frame realize multiple fixation to transformer core group, compared to traditional single fixed form, show What is write improves the tightness fixed to transformer core group, enhances the stability fixed to transformer core group.
(2) the transformer fe core assembly installation assembly is connected by being equipped with sliding on the outside of top fixed frame and bottom fixing frame Joint chair, so as to cooperate the slide bar on sliding connecting base and mounting rack to transformer core group the carry out level tune on mounting rack Section, so that the transformer core group can be finely adjusted during installation, enhanced convenience when installation enhances the transformer core group The practicability of part installation assembly.
